Painting Description
"Acqua Acetosa (bords du Tibre dans la campagne de Rome)" is a captivating landscape painting by the renowned French artist Jean-Baptiste-Camille Corot, created in 1826. Corot, a pivotal figure in the Barbizon School, is celebrated for his contributions to landscape painting and his role in bridging the Neoclassical tradition with the emerging Impressionist movement. This particular work exemplifies his early style, characterized by meticulous attention to detail and a harmonious composition that captures the serene beauty of the Roman countryside.
The painting depicts the tranquil banks of the Tiber River near Acqua Acetosa, a location known for its picturesque scenery and mineral springs, which were popular among locals and travelers alike. Corot's choice of this subject reflects his deep appreciation for nature and his ability to convey its subtle nuances through his art. The composition is marked by a balanced interplay of light and shadow, with the soft, diffused light of the Italian landscape lending a dreamlike quality to the scene.
Corot's technique in "Acqua Acetosa" showcases his mastery of plein air painting, a method he employed to capture the natural environment with immediacy and authenticity. The delicate brushwork and the use of a muted, earthy palette evoke a sense of calm and timelessness, inviting viewers to immerse themselves in the tranquil atmosphere of the Roman countryside. This work not only highlights Corot's technical skill but also his ability to evoke emotion and a sense of place, making it a significant piece in his oeuvre.
"Acqua Acetosa (bords du Tibre dans la campagne de Rome)" stands as a testament to Corot's enduring legacy in the world of landscape painting. It reflects his profound connection to nature and his innovative approach that paved the way for future generations of artists. Today, this painting is admired for its serene beauty and its role in the evolution of landscape art in the 19th century.
